Calibration Services for Ashland Properties

Modern vehicles may require calibration after collision repair, windshield replacement, alignment changes, suspension work, or sensor-related component service. Star Body Works reviews the vehicle and repair context, identifies the applicable procedure, and explains why calibration is or is not part of the plan.

Planning the Right Calibration Services Scope

Not every warning or repair requires calibration, and calibration does not fix unrelated mechanical or electrical faults. Requirements vary by make, model, installed equipment, repair procedure, component condition, and work environment.

When might calibration be required?

It may be required after certain collision repairs, windshield replacements, alignment or suspension work, or service involving cameras and sensors.
